Here is how Whitmore handles bird removal from start to finish:
- Inspect the property to identify nesting sites, entry points, and the bird species involved
- Remove active nests and clear accumulated droppings from roofs, attics, and solar panel systems
- Install physical barriers such as shields or panels to block birds from returning to high-risk areas
- Apply visual deterrents including reflectors to discourage pigeons, swallows, and woodpeckers from re-establishing
- Patch or replace damaged siding with woodpecker-resistant materials to close off entry points
- Provide follow-up recommendations to keep nesting activity from starting again

Frequently Asked Questions
Are bird control methods permanent?
Effectiveness varies by bird species and method. Physical barriers and proper nesting prevention provide long-term results, while visual deterrents may need ongoing monitoring and replacement over time.
Can bird control be customized for my property?
Yes. We tailor solutions based on the type of bird, nesting location, roof type, and property design to provide both effective and aesthetically appropriate results.
How do you manage pigeons on roofs or attics?
For roosting or perching pigeons, we may apply temporary repellents. For nesting pigeons, we can remove nests, install barriers, and perform attic restoration if needed. We also provide barrier installation under solar panels to prevent nesting and re-entry. Durable construction materials, like wood or aluminum boxes, are used for long-term protection and aesthetic appeal.
How do you prevent mud swallows from building nests?
We use physical deterrents, such as netting, or visual deterrents like reflectors and shields. If nests are already built, we remove them once the hatchlings are able to fly safely.
